Employment Specialist ICentral City Concern is seeking a compassionate, resourceful, and mission-driven Employment Specialist I to support individuals impacted by homelessness, poverty, mental health challenges, and substance use disorders as they pursue meaningful employment. In this role, you will partner with clients throughout their employment journey, helping them identify career goals, overcome barriers, secure employment, and maintain long-term success in work, housing, and recovery.At CCC, employment is more than a job. It is a pathway to stability, self-sufficiency, and personal transformation. As an Employment Specialist, you will play a direct role in helping individuals build confidence, develop workforce skills, connect to opportunities, and achieve lasting success.What You'll DoProvide individualized employment coaching, career exploration, and job retention support.Help clients develop employment plans, career maps, resumes, cover letters, and interview skills.Connect clients to community resources that address barriers such as housing, transportation, behavioral health, and basic needs.Build relationships with employers and match clients to appropriate employment opportunities.Monitor client progress, document services, and maintain accurate records within case management systems.Collaborate closely with CCC programs, housing teams, and community partners to provide coordinated support.What You BringHigh school diploma or GED plus experience in workforce development, employment services, job coaching, social services, or a related field.Strong relationship-building, communication, and problem-solving skills.Ability to support individuals experiencing multiple barriers to employment with empathy and professionalism.Excellent organization, documentation, and time-management skills.Commitment to recovery-oriented, trauma-informed, and client-centered services.Join CCCIf you are passionate about helping people achieve economic independence and believe in the power of employment as a tool for recovery and stability, this is an opportunity to make a meaningful impact every day while advancing CCC's mission to end homelessness through outcome-based strategies that support personal and community transformation.Location: Employment Access Center - 2 NW 2nd Ave, Portland, OR 97209Schedule: Monday - Friday, 8:00am - 4:30pm (Saturdays & Sundays Off)Compensation: $22.73/hr - $30.15/hr.
